ANDREA DEL SARTO
High Renaissance Florentine Painter
Influences: Fra Bartolomeo, Michelangelo, andLeonardo Da Vinci
Cause of Death - Plague, "he died, aged forty-two, on the 22nd of January, , and was buried very quietly by the Brethren of the Scalzo in the church of the S.
Annunziata."

Andrea grew up in a family of tailors and cobblers. His name "Andrea del Sarto", literally means "the tailor's Andrew", sarto is the Italian word for tailor. Andrea Del Sarto's rose quickly in the ranks of Florentine painters and was in high demand while still a young painter.
His reputation was so great that the King of France invited him to court. The following insight into Andrea Del Sarto life is From Giorgio Vasari's: Lives of the Most Eminent Painters, Sculptors, and Architects published in c.
